Airbnb Seasonality Analysis & Trends in Town of Digby (2025)
Peak Season (November, July, August)
- Revenue averages $3,086 per month
- Occupancy rates average 69.1%
- Daily rates average $129
Shoulder Season
- Revenue averages $2,082 per month
- Occupancy maintains around 49.4%
- Daily rates hold near $124
Low Season (February, March, October)
- Revenue drops to average $1,002 per month
- Occupancy decreases to average 23.4%
- Daily rates adjust to average $121
Seasonality Insights for Town of Digby
- The Airbnb seasonality in Town of Digby shows highly seasonal trends requiring careful strategy. While the sections above show seasonal averages, it's also insightful to look at the extremes:
- During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Town of Digby's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ues capable of climbing to $3,224, occupancy reaching a high of 70.0%, and ADRs peaking at $130.
- Conversely, the slowest single month of the year, typically falling within the low season, marks the market's lowest point. In this month, revenue might dip to $757, occupancy could drop to 17.8%, and ADRs may adjust down to $118.

Best Areas for Airbnb Investment in Town of Digby (2025)
Exploring the top neighborhoods for short-term rentals in Town of Digby? This section highlights key areas, outlining why they are attractive for hosts and guests, along with notable local attractions. Consider these locations based on your target guest profile and investment strategy.
Neighborhood / Area | Why Host Here? (Target Guests & Appeal) | Key Attractions & Landmarks |
---|---|---|
Digby Harbour | A picturesque harbor area known for its fishing boats and waterfront views. Popular for travelers looking to enjoy fresh seafood and maritime activities. | Digby Pines Golf Resort & Spa, The Lobster Pound, Digby Farmer's Market, Admiral Digby Museum |
Fundy Drive | This scenic drive is famous for the stunning views of the Bay of Fundy, home to the highest tides in the world. Ideal for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ts. | The Pines Golf Course, Lighthouse at Cape Saint Mary, Fundy Tidal Interpretive Centre, Birdwatching at Digby Neck |
Smith's Cove | A charming coastal community known for its beautiful beaches and relaxed atmosphere. Great for families and those looking for a peaceful vacation spot. | Smith's Cove Beach, Whale Watching Tours, Local artisan shops, Parks and picnic areas |
St. John’s Church Area | A historical part of Digby that showcases beautiful architecture and cultural heritage. Attracts tourists interested in history and local culture. | St. John’s Anglican Church, Heritage Buildings, Digby Historic District, Cultural Events |
Brier Island | A remote island known for its stunning views and rich wildlife. Perfect for adventurous travelers and those looking to disconnect from the city. | Brier Island Whale Watch, Grand Passage Lighthouse, Seabird watching, Hiking Trails |
Digby Neck | Known for its natural beauty and stunning coastlines. Popular for visitors looking to explore rugged landscapes and small fishing villages. | Boat Tours, Scenic Lookouts, Cultural Heritage Sites |
The Digby Wharf | A bustling area with shops and restaurants by the water, attracting tourists seeking local food and crafts. | Wharf Seafood Restaurants, Seasonal Festivals, Fishing Tours, Local Art Galleries |
Annapolis Basin | A beautiful basin that offers scenic views and a variety of outdoor activities. Ideal for those seeking a getaway with nature. | Kayaking and Canoeing, Annapolis Basin Lookoff, Hiking Trails, Beach Areas |

Town of Digby STR Booking Lead Time Analysis (2025)
Average Booking Lead Time by Month
Booking Lead Time Insights for Town of Digby
- The overall average booking lead time for vacation rentals in Town of Digby is 70 days.
- Guests book furthest in advance for stays during April (average 129 days), likely coinciding with peak travel demand or local events.
- The shortest booking windows occur for stays in February (average 4 days), indicating more last-minute travel plans during this time.
- Seasonally, Spring (87 days avg.) sees the longest lead times, while Winter (19 days avg.) has the shortest, reflecting typical travel planning cycles.
